Case study summary
Our client allegedly swore at a neighbour's child and pushed him off his bike following an argument between the child and her son. We highlighted the weaknesses in the case to the police and advised our client on how to approach the interview. The investigation was discontinued.
Case study
Our client was a 33-year-old mother. Her son was 8-years-old and she was expecting her second child. Following a disagreement between her son and her neighbour's child, our client was accused of swearing at the child and shoulder barging him off his pedal bike.
During a consultation with our client prior to the police interview, she denied the allegation. Our client explained that the child had been bullying her son for many weeks. On this occasion, her son had returned home visibly upset after her neighbour's child had thrown rocks at him. Our client approached the child and asked him where his parents were. She did not assault him.
At the police interview, one of our expert assault solicitors discussed the evidence with the police officer in charge of the case. The officer stated that three witness statements had been provided to the police. However, upon further questioning, the officer admitted that each statement contained a different version of events. It also became apparent that the complaint came from the child's mother rather than the child himself. We highlighted to the officer the weakness in the case.
We advised our client as to how to proceed with the interview based on this information and one week later the investigation was discontinued. Our client can now continue to enjoy her pregnancy and look forward to her new arrival without the stress of a police investigation hanging over her.
